Streamflow Reports Record $280K Revenue in September, Powering 25K+ Projects
Streamflow, the leading token distribution platform on Solana, has reported impressive growth. In September 2022, it generated over $280,000 in protocol revenue, marking a significant increase from August's $235,000. This success comes amidst a peak TVL of ~$2.5 billion, over 1.3 million users, and 25,000+ projects powered across multiple blockchains.
Streamflow's revenue growth is driven by its no-code products for token distribution and an SDK for direct integration into external applications. Notably, over $62,800 was distributed to $STREAM stakers through its Active Staking Rewards program, the highest monthly payouts to date. This represents over 30% of Streamflow's revenue, demonstrating its commitment to rewarding active participants.
The platform's security and non-custodial nature have contributed to its success. It aligns token incentives throughout the entire token lifecycle, ensuring fairness and efficiency. The total supply of $STREAM that is staked has climbed to over 57 million, representing 42.2% of the circulating supply.
